Check For Maximum Soil Pressure:


Critical Column No = C6
Critical Load Combination = [2] : (LOAD 5: DEAD LOAD) +(LOAD 6:
LIVE LOAD) +(LOAD 1: EQX)
Pcomb = 728.55 kN
P = Pcomb + W1
P = 1158.77 kN
Mx = 248.85 kNm
My = 16.99 kNm
P/A = 82.4 kN/sqm
Mx/Zx = 28.31 kN/sqm
My/Zy = 1.93 kN/sqm
Maximum Soil Pressure = 112.65 kN/sqm
Allowable Soil Pressure = (1.25 X 80) + 27 kN/sqm

14-05-2025 16:04:02 PM 4/8


= 127 kN/sqm

Check For Minimum Soil Pressure:


Critical Column No = C20
Critical Load Combination = [4] : (LOAD 5: DEAD
LOAD) +(LOAD 6: LIVE
LOAD) -(LOAD 1: EQX)
Pcomb = 333.58 kN
P = Pcomb + W1
P = 763.8 kN
Mx = -228.96 kNm
My = -3.28 kNm
P/A = 54.31 kN/sqm
Mx/Zx = -26.05 kN/sqm
My/Zy = -0.37 kN/sqm
Minimum Soil Pressure = 27.89 kN/sqm
> 0

Design For Bending:


Bottom Reinforcement Along L:
Critical Column No = C6
Critical Load Combination = [19] : 1.5 (LOAD 5: DEAD LOAD) +1.5
(LOAD 1: EQX)
Pu = 987.65 kN
Mux = 373.32 kNm
Muy = 25.9 kNm
P/A = 70.23 kN/sqm
Mx/Zx = 42.48 kN/sqm
My/Zy = 2.95 kN/sqm

Deff = 777 mm
Beff = 950 mm
SPu = 112.71 kN/sqm
Mu = SPu X B X Loff X Loff / 2
= 491.47 kNm
Pt = 0.372 %
Ast Rqd (BM) = 2744 sqmm
Ast Prv (Distributed Across Total = 26 - T12 @ 150
Width)
= 2941 sqmm

Bottom Reinforcement Along B:


Critical Column No = C6
Critical Load Combination = [23] : 1.5 (LOAD 5: DEAD LOAD) +1.5
(LOAD 2: EQZ)
Pu = 1046.28 kN
Mux = 22.97 kNm

14-05-2025 16:04:02 PM 5/8


Muy = 269.05 kNm
P/A = 74.4 kN/sqm
Mx/Zx = 2.61 kN/sqm
My/Zy = 30.61 kN/sqm

Deff = 761 mm
Leff = 1256.25 mm
SPu = 105.01 kN/sqm
Mu = SPu X L X Boff X Boff / 2
= 569.04 kNm
Pt = 0.297 %
Ast Rqd (BM) = 2843 sqmm
Ast Prv (Distributed Across Total
= 26 - T12 @ 150
Length)
= 2941 sqmm

Design For Shear:


One Way Shear Along L:
Critical Section @ d from Column Face
= 777 mm
Critical Column No = C6
Critical Load Combination = [19] : 1.5 (LOAD 5: DEAD LOAD) +1.5
(LOAD 1: EQX)
Pu = 987.65 kN
Mux = 373.32 kNm
Muy = 25.9 kNm
P/A = 70.23 kN/sqm
Mx/Zx = 42.48 kN/sqm
My/Zy = 2.95 kN/sqm

Deff = 551 mm
Beff = 2070.28 mm
SPu = 112.71 kN/sqm
Vu = SPu X (Loff - d) X B
= 316.15 kN
Tv = Vu / (Beff X Deff)
= 0.28 N/sqmm
Tc = 0.43 N/sqmm
Tv < Tc

One Way Shear Along B:


Critical Section @ d from Column Face

= 761 mm
Critical Column No = C6
Critical Load Combination = [23] : 1.5 (LOAD 5: DEAD

14-05-2025 16:04:02 PM 6/8


LOAD) +1.5 (LOAD 2:
EQZ)
Pu = 1046.28 kN
Mux = 22.97 kNm
Muy = 269.05 kNm
P/A = 74.4 kN/sqm
Mx/Zx = 2.61 kN/sqm
My/Zy = 30.61 kN/sqm

Deff = 565 mm
Leff = 2077.41 mm
SPu = 105.01 kN/sqm
Vu = SPu X (Boff - d) X L
= 369.78 kN
Tv = Vu / (Leff X Deff)
= 0.32 N/sqmm
Tc = 0.39 N/sqmm
Tv < Tc

Design For Punching Shear:


Critical Section @ d/2 from Column Face
= 384 mm

Critical Column No = C2
Critical Load Combination = [23] : 1.5 (LOAD 5: DEAD LOAD) +1.5
(LOAD 2: EQZ)
Pu = 1046.83 kN
Mux = 57.51 kNm
Muy = 244.43 kNm
P/A = 74.44 kN/sqm
Mx/Zx = 6.54 kN/sqm
My/Zy = 27.81 kN/sqm

Deff = 685 mm
Leff = 1469 mm
Beff = 1119 mm
Punching Perimeter = 5176 mm
Punching Area = 3543179.04 sqmm
SPu = Average Pressure
= 74.44 kN/sqm
Vu = SPu X ((L X B)-(Leff X Beff))
= 924.46 kN
Tv = Vu / Punching Area
= 0.261 N/sqmm
Tc = 1.25 N/sqmm
Tv < Tc

Load Transfer Check For Load Transfer From Column To Footing
Critical Column No = C2
Critical Load Combination = [23] : 1.5 (LOAD 5: DEAD
LOAD) +1.5 (LOAD 2:
EQZ)
Pu = 1046.83 kN
A2 = 0.25 sqm
A1 = 14.6 sqm
Base Area = 14.06 sqm
A1 > Base Area
Thus, A1 = 14.06
Modification Factor = SquareRoot(A1/A2) < =
2
SquareRoot(A1/A2) = 7.4993
Thus, Modification Factor = 2
Concrete Bearing Capacity = 0.45 X Fck X Modification Factor X Column
Area
= 5512.5 kN
Concrete Bearing Capacity > Pu, Hence Safe.
